1999 Renault Laguna vs. 2007 Panoz Esperante

To start off, 2007 Panoz Esperante is newer by 8 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1999 Renault Laguna.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1999 Renault Laguna would be higher. At 4,589 cc (8 cylinders), 2007 Panoz Esperante is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Panoz Esperante (305 HP @ 5800 RPM) has 167 more horse power than 1999 Renault Laguna. (138 HP @ 5750 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2007 Panoz Esperante should accelerate faster than 1999 Renault Laguna.

Because 2007 Panoz Esperante is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2007 Panoz Esperante.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1999 Renault Laguna,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2007 Panoz Esperante (434 Nm @ 4200 RPM) has 253 more torque (in Nm) than 1999 Renault Laguna. (181 Nm @ 3750 RPM). This means 2007 Panoz Esperante will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1999 Renault Laguna.

Compare all specifications:

1999 Renault Laguna 2007 Panoz Esperante
Make Renault Panoz
Model Laguna Esperante
Year Released 1999 2007
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2068 cc 4589 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 8 cylinders
Engine Type in-line V
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 138 HP 305 HP
Engine RPM 5750 RPM 5800 RPM
Torque 181 Nm 434 Nm
Torque RPM 3750 RPM 4200 RPM
Engine Bore Size 88 mm 90.2 mm
Engine Stroke Size 89 mm 90 mm
Drive Type Front Rear
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 5 seats 2 seats
Vehicle Length 4640 mm 4480 mm
Vehicle Width 1760 mm 1870 mm
Vehicle Height 1440 mm 1360 mm
Wheelbase Size 2680 mm 2700 mm
